Shella McGregor, 80, of Princeton

Shella R. McGregor, age 80, of Princeton, KY, and originally of Dawson Springs, KY, passed away on May 10, 2026, at Princeton Nursing & Rehab, Princeton, KY. She was born April 20, 1946, to Alvin Goodaker and Martha Magdaline Martin Goodaker. She was a devoted member of her beloved church, Mt. Pisgah Missionary Baptist Church. Ms. McGregor worked at Ottenheimer Manufacturing in Dawson Springs for 17 years, and she and her husband were in charge of the maintenance of the Mt. Pisgah Missionary Baptist Church. She was also a Certified Nurse Assistant and set privately with people.

Ms McGregor was a devoted wife, mother, grandmother, and she was a devout Christian. She loved singing, writing songs and poetry, spoiling grandkids, and attending every activity they were in. Additionally, she loved watching sports.
